    Present perfect simple



    Present perfect simple

    "have" in the present tense ("have", except for the 3rd person singular = "has") + past participle (verb + -ED for regular verbs / You should learn irregular verbs)

    AssertionHe has worked in a big firm. = He's worked in a big firm. 

    With another subject:
    I have worked in a big firm. (= I've worked)


    If there is an adverb -> it is between the auxiliary and the past participle.
    He has just sung.

    Except for NOT... YET at the end of the sentence:
    He has not sung yet. 


    Negation: He has not worked in that firm. He hasn't worked in that firm.
    I have not worked (= I haven't worked)...


    Questions: 
    Have you ever seen him in that firm?
